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of fire fighting, and particularly discloses a hor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device special for an unmanned aerial vehicle. Comprising a mounting mechanism and a throwing mechanism. The mounting mechanism is used for being connected with the unmanned aerial vehicle and fixing the fire extinguishing bomb, and the throwing mechanism is arranged at the bottom of the mounting mechanism and used for controlling release of the fire extinguishing bomb. A steering engine is arranged at the top of the mounting mechanism, and precise throwing is achieved through linkage of a third shaft of the steering engine and the throwing mechanism. In a preferable scheme, the throwing mechanism can adopt a sliding type, a hanging lug type or a belt type structure to adapt to different fire extinguishing bomb types; the steering engine is equipped with a displacement sensor to monitor the stroke in real time to improve the control precision. The device is compact in structure and flexible to install, supports modular expansion, solves the problems that a traditional fire extinguishing bomb throwing device is insufficient in precision, delayed in response and poor in adaptability, and remarkably improves the fire extinguishing efficiency and reliability of the unmanned aerial vehicle. The system is suitable for various scenes such as forest fire control and urban rescue.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of fire protection technology, and in particular to a hor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device for drones. Background Technology

[0002] In the field of drone-based firefighting, the precise delivery of fire extinguishing grenades is crucial to ensuring fire suppression efficiency. Traditional fire extinguishing grenades suspension devices often employ simple mechanical release structures or electronic triggering mechanisms, which suffer from problems such as inaccurate timing control, response delays, or false triggering. For example, some devices rely on a single signal trigger, making them susceptible to environmental interference; others use fixed-delay delivery, which is difficult to adapt to the dynamic needs of fire scenes. Furthermore, existing technologies often lack reliable travel feedback mechanisms, resulting in insufficient stability and consistency in delivery actions, thus affecting fire suppression effectiveness.

[0003] Traditional mechanical release mechanisms often employ electromagnet triggering or simple mechanical latch designs. While these structures are simple and reliable, they have significant functional drawbacks: First, the timing of deployment lacks precision, making it difficult to achieve millisecond-level accurate triggering, resulting in large deviations in the landing point of the fire extinguishing projectile. Second, they lack an effective status monitoring mechanism, failing to provide real-time feedback on the working status of the release mechanism, posing a risk of false triggering or jamming. While electronic triggering devices offer improved control precision, they are susceptible to interference in complex electromagnetic environments and require high power supply stability, making reliability difficult to guarantee during field operations. Existing devices also lack versatility, often only compatible with specific types of fire extinguishing projectiles. When changing the type of fire extinguishing projectile is necessary, the entire suspension system must be redesigned and reinstalled, severely impacting the rapid response capability of the fire extinguishing system.

[0004] The patent "A Fire Extinguishing Bullet Mounting Device for Firefighting Drones" (application number CN202121527119.6, hereinafter referred to as Prior Art 1) discloses a fire extinguishing bullet mounting device. Prior Art 1 provides a drone mounting mechanism that can flexibly adjust the position and angle of the mounted items through a mounting adjustment mechanism and a camera adjustment structure, achieving rapid adaptation to different equipment and improving mounting flexibility. It also optimizes the application range of cameras and other equipment, reduces drone resource waste, and enhances the drone's multi-functional application capabilities. However, Prior Art 1 can only change the position and angle of the fire extinguishing bullet, and cannot universally mount multiple types of fire extinguishing bullets. Furthermore, it lacks a precise release control mechanism. In complex environments, especially under conditions of strong electromagnetic interference or unstable power supply, the reliability of Prior Art 1's mounting and release functions is insufficient. [0035] Example 1

[0036] Please see Figure 1This utility model provides a dedicated hor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device for drones. In actual fire extinguishing scenarios, there are various different fire conditions, and different fire extinguishing measures are required depending on the fire condition. Therefore, different fire extinguishing bombs are needed in drone fire extinguishing. However, different fire extinguishing bombs have different structures, and the required installation structures are also different. In the traditional way, different types of drones are often used to transport different fire extinguishing bombs. This not only increases the cost of fire extinguishing equipment, but also greatly reduces the fire extinguishing efficiency in practical applications due to the frequent replacement of different types of drones.

[0037] To address this issue, this invention proposes a dedicated hor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device for drones, which adapts to the needs of different fire extinguishing bombs by setting a detachable suspension device.

[0038] In this embodiment, the drone-specific horizontal fire extinguishing projectile suspension device is used to install horizontal material projectiles. Horizontal material projectiles are airdrop equipment used in disaster relief, deployed by helicopters or fixed-wing aircraft, utilizing parachutes or cushioning devices to ensure the smooth landing of supplies (such as medicine, food, and tools) in the disaster area. Their core function is to solve the problem of material transportation when transportation is disrupted, rather than fire extinguishing. In terms of effectiveness, it can achieve long-range, precise delivery, but it needs to consider factors such as weather and terrain, and it does not have fire extinguishing capabilities.

[0039] Please see Figure 1 In this embodiment, the UAV-specific hor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device includes a mounting mechanism and a throwing mechanism. The mounting mechanism is a mounting plate 110; the throwing mechanism is a sliding throwing mechanism 210. The mounting mechanism is used to connect to the UAV and mount the fire extinguishing bomb. The fire extinguishing bomb is mounted on the UAV mounting mechanism via the sliding throwing mechanism 210. The throwing mechanism fixes or releases the fire extinguishing bomb. The UAV-specific hor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device also includes a servo motor 300 for controlling the timing of the throwing mechanism releasing the fire extinguishing bomb. The servo motor 300 and the throwing mechanism are respectively located at the top and bottom of the mounting plate 110.

[0040] In use, the fire extinguishing bomb is first mounted on the sliding throwing mechanism 210, and then connected to the mounting mechanism via a drone to propel the fire extinguishing bomb to the fire scene. Upon reaching the designated location, the throwing mechanism is controlled by a servo motor 300, causing the sliding throwing mechanism 210 to release the fire extinguishing bomb, achieving rapid and accurate fire extinguishing. This design not only simplifies the mounting and releasing process of the fire extinguishing bomb but also greatly improves fire extinguishing efficiency and flexibility. Furthermore, since both the mounting and throwing mechanisms are detachable, different types of fire extinguishing bombs can be easily adapted, avoiding the need for frequent drone replacements and reducing the cost of fire extinguishing equipment.

[0041] Further, please see Figure 1 and Figure 2 The sliding throwing mechanism 210 is disposed at the bottom of the mounting plate 110, including a slide rail 211 and a first slider 212 and a second slider 213 that can slide based on the slide rail 211; the first slider 212 and the second slider 213 are both used to hang the fire extinguishing bomb; and the first slider 212 is provided with a limiting hole 213, and the third shaft 333 extends into the limiting hole 213. When the third shaft 333 retracts and leaves the limiting hole 213, the first slider 212 can move freely on the slide rail 211.

[0042] In use, the fire extinguishing bomb is mounted on the slide rail 211 via the first slider 212 and the second slider 213. When the drone flies to the designated location, the servo motor 300 controls the drone to tilt towards the preset target position at a certain angle, or to tilt the slide rail 211, allowing the first slider 212 to slide freely on the slide rail 211, thereby moving the fire extinguishing bomb mounted on it along the direction of the slide rail 211. If the second slider 213 also slides synchronously, the fire extinguishing bomb will be smoothly and quickly launched to the target position, achieving precise delivery. This sliding launching mechanism 210 design not only makes the launching process of the fire extinguishing bomb more stable and controllable.

[0043] Further, please see Figure 2 The servo motor 300 includes a mounting bracket 310 and a driver 320 disposed on the mounting bracket 310; the first shaft 331 is fixedly connected to the output shaft of the driver 320, and the two ends of the second shaft 332 are respectively hinged to the first shaft 331 and the third shaft 333; a displacement sensor 334 is also provided on one side of the first shaft 331 on the mounting bracket 310 for detecting the stroke of the first shaft 331.

[0044] The mounting bracket 310 is also provided with a guide block 335, and the third shaft 333 is connected to the throwing mechanism via the guide block 335 to achieve a retractable relationship.

[0045] The servo motor 300 includes a first shaft 331, a second shaft 332, and a third shaft 333; the servo motor 300 controls the retraction relationship between the third shaft 333 and the throwing mechanism to realize the timing of the fire extinguishing bomb release.

[0046] In use, the servo motor 300 controls the third shaft 333 to insert into the limiting hole 213 of the first slider 212, thus restricting the position of the first slider 212 to the slide rail 211 and preventing it from moving. When it is necessary to throw the fire extinguishing bomb, the driver 320 is activated to rotate the output shaft, thereby driving the first shaft 331 to rotate. The second shaft 332 and the third shaft 333 move along a preset trajectory as the first shaft 331 rotates, causing the third shaft 333 to disengage from the limiting hole 213 and lose its restriction on the position of the first slider 212. This allows the first slider 212 and the second slider 213 to drive the fire extinguishing bomb to move along the slide rail 211, achieving the throwing. When the first shaft 331 moves to a preset position and is detected by the displacement sensor 334, the driver 320 is turned off. At this time, the first shaft 331 stops rotating, and the second shaft 332 and the third shaft 333 also stop moving.

[0047] During this process, the movement trajectory of the third axis 333 is precisely controlled due to the presence of the guide block 335, ensuring the accuracy and stability of the retraction of the throwing mechanism. At the same time, this design also makes the servo motor 300 more flexible and reliable in controlling the timing of the fire extinguishing grenade release, allowing it to adjust the throwing force and angle according to actual needs.

[0048] Furthermore, please see Figure 4 The drone-specific hor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device further includes a first connecting frame 410 and a second connecting frame 420, which are symmetrically arranged; the mounting mechanism is disposed between the first connecting frame 410 and the second connecting frame 420 and is detachably connected to the first connecting frame 410 and the second connecting frame 420.

[0049] In this embodiment, the fire extinguishing bomb is positioned at a specific location between the first connecting frame 410 and the second connecting frame 420. These two connecting frames not only protect the fire extinguishing bomb, ensuring its safety during transportation and storage, but also help increase its distance from the ground before launch. This design effectively prevents damage to the fire extinguishing bomb from ground contact during launch, while also providing the necessary space for it to smoothly detach from the ground and reach the expected flight altitude and range.

[0050] Example 2

[0051] Please see Figure 5 This utility model provides a special horizontal fire extinguishing bullet suspension device for UAVs. In embodiment 1, the horizontal fire extinguishing bullet is long and narrow with a large length and a small diameter. However, for fire extinguishing bullets with a large diameter, due to their weight and center of gravity distribution, it is not convenient to mount them via the slide rail 211.

[0052] Therefore, in Embodiment 2 of this utility model, a mounting scheme for fire extinguishing bombs with larger diameters is provided. For example, the Dragon Wing fire extinguishing bomb is a long-range precision fire extinguishing device, typically deployed by drones or aircraft, utilizing aerodynamic design to glide to the target fire site. It is filled with dry powder, gel, or flame retardant, and can be released in the air or upon impact, rapidly covering a large area of ​​fire source, suitable for difficult-to-access emergencies such as forest fires and high-rise building fires. In terms of effectiveness, it can overcome terrain limitations, achieve efficient fire extinguishing, and reduce the direct risks faced by firefighters, but it relies on vehicles for delivery, resulting in higher costs.

[0053] In this embodiment, the mounting mechanism is a mounting frame 120, which is disposed between the first connecting frame 410 and the second connecting frame 420, and there is at least one mounting frame 120; the mounting frame 120 is provided with an installation space for accommodating the fire extinguishing bomb.

[0054] The mounting frame 120 is provided with an installation range for mounting the fire extinguishing bomb. By placing the fire extinguishing bomb in this range and clamping the center of gravity of the fire extinguishing bomb with the mounting frame 120, the stability and safety of the fire extinguishing bomb during the mounting process can be ensured.

[0055] The mounting bracket 120 is also equipped with a locking mechanism to secure the fire extinguishing bombs and prevent them from falling off during flight due to airflow or other factors.

[0056] When the fire extinguishing bomb is delivered to the preset position, the locking mechanism is opened by the servo motor 300, so that the fire extinguishing bomb can be successfully deployed to the target area.

[0057] The locking mechanism can be the belt throwing mechanism 230 in Embodiment 4 or other locking mechanisms.

[0058] Example 3

[0059] Please see Figure 3This utility model provides a suspension device for a horizontal fire extinguishing grenade specifically designed for drones. In Embodiment 1, the horizontal fire extinguishing grenade is elongated, while in Embodiment 2, the dragon-wing fire extinguishing grenade is cylindrical with a larger diameter. However, for spherical fire extinguishing grenade, the suspension devices in Embodiments 1 and 2 are not suitable due to the shape and center of gravity of the spherical fire extinguishing grenade. For example, throwable fire extinguishing grenades, spherical throwable fire extinguishing grenades, are portable emergency fire extinguishing devices. They are thrown manually or launched from a simple launcher, releasing an extinguishing agent (such as dry powder or gas) instantly upon impact with the fire source. They are suitable for initial fires in homes, vehicles, or in the wild, quickly suppressing small-scale fires. Operation is simple and requires no professional training. In terms of effectiveness, they are fast-responding and low-cost, but the throwing distance is limited (usually <50 meters), and they are for single use only, making them suitable for emergency evacuation rather than prolonged fire extinguishing.

[0060] Therefore, the suspension device was further optimized in this embodiment to accommodate the spherical fire extinguishing projectile.

[0061] The throwing mechanism is a hook-and-throw mechanism 220; the fire extinguishing bomb is hung on the hook-and-throw mechanism 220; the third shaft 333 is connected to the hook-and-throw mechanism 220, and when the third shaft 333 extends and pushes the hook 221 of the hook-and-throw mechanism 220, the hook 221 opens and throws the fire extinguishing bomb.

[0062] In use, first place the fire extinguishing bomb on the lug-mounted throwing mechanism 220 and ensure it is securely mounted. Then, start the drone and fly it over the target fire source. Once the drone reaches the designated position, activate the third axis 333 via the servo motor 300. The third axis 333 quickly extends and pushes the lug 221 of the lug-mounted throwing mechanism 220. The lug 221 opens rapidly under the thrust, simultaneously releasing the mounted spherical fire extinguishing bomb. The fire extinguishing bomb detaches from the lug 221 under gravity and flies towards the fire source along a predetermined parabolic trajectory. Upon impact with the fire source, the fire extinguishing bomb instantly releases its internal extinguishing agent, quickly extinguishing the fire and achieving rapid fire suppression. The entire process is simple to operate and reacts quickly, making it particularly suitable for initial fire suppression in emergency situations.

[0063] Example 4

[0064] Please see Figure 1 This utility model provides a special horizontal fire extinguishing bomb suspension device for drones. The throwing mechanism is a belt throwing mechanism 230. The belt throwing mechanism 230 includes a mounting part 231 and a locking part 232, and a limiting belt 233 disposed between the mounting part 231 and the locking part 232. One end of the belt is connected to the mounting part 231, and the other end is provided with a locking head 234 that engages with the locking part 232. The mounting part 231 and the locking part 232 are respectively provided at both ends of the mounting frame 120.

[0065] For cylindrical fire extinguishing bombs with a similar large diameter as in Embodiment 2, the belt throwing mechanism 230 can more flexibly adapt to fire extinguishing bombs of different sizes and shapes. In this embodiment, the belt throwing mechanism 230 consists of a mounting part 231, a locking part 232, and a limiting belt 233. The mounting part 231 and the locking part 232 are respectively fixed to the two ends of the mounting frame 120, and they are connected by the limiting belt 233. One end of the limiting belt 233 is firmly connected to the mounting part 231, and the other end is provided with a locking head 234, which can be locked and fixed with the locking part 232.

[0066] When it is necessary to load fire extinguishing bombs, the bombs are first placed on the belt-mounted throwing mechanism 230. Then, by adjusting the tension of the limiting belt 233, the locking head 234 is tightly engaged with the locking part 232, ensuring that the fire extinguishing bomb is securely mounted on the device. After the UAV flies over the target fire source and reaches the predetermined position, the servo motor 300 is activated to drive the third shaft 333. This third shaft 333 pushes the locking head 234 away from the locking part 232, causing the limiting belt 233 to quickly loosen. Under the action of gravity, the fire extinguishing bomb flies towards the fire source along a predetermined trajectory, achieving rapid fire extinguishing. This belt-mounted throwing mechanism 230 is not only simple in structure but also easy to operate, greatly improving fire extinguishing efficiency.
